首页
/ Docusaurus中文文档中警告块语法缺失问题解析

Docusaurus中文文档中警告块语法缺失问题解析

2025-04-30 01:52:06作者:秋泉律Samson

在开源文档工具Docusaurus的中文文档维护过程中,发现了一个典型的Markdown语法完整性导致的渲染问题。该问题涉及文档中警告块(admonitions)的语法结构缺失,影响了中文版文档的正确显示。

警告块是Docusaurus中用于突出显示提示、警告等内容的特殊语法结构,其标准格式为三个冒号包裹的代码块:

:::tip
这里是提示内容
:::

在简体中文(zh-Hans)翻译版本中,部分警告块的结束标记:::被意外删除。这种语法不完整会导致以下问题:

  1. 警告块无法正常闭合
  2. 后续的非警告内容被错误地包含在警告块中
  3. 文档整体结构被打乱

这类问题通常发生在协作翻译过程中,当译者未完整保留原始文档的特殊语法标记时。对于包含代码、公式或特殊语法的文档内容,保持原始标记的完整性至关重要。

项目维护者通过以下方式解决了该问题:

  1. 识别出存在语法缺失的警告块
  2. 在翻译平台上修正或重新翻译相关段落
  3. 确保所有特殊语法标记得到保留

这个案例提醒我们,在参与开源文档翻译时,译者需要特别注意:

  • 保留所有非文本内容的结构标记
  • 在修改内容时检查前后语法是否完整
  • 对不确定的语法结构应查阅原始文档

Docusaurus作为流行的文档工具,其多语言支持功能依赖于社区贡献。保持翻译质量不仅需要语言能力,还需要对技术文档特殊格式的理解和维护意识。

登录后查看全文
热门项目推荐
相关项目推荐